Joel, Indycals are inexpensive enough that it's worthwhile to buy an extra sheet if there are a lot of white bits. The other silk screen manufacturers I've used (Shunko, Studio 27, Hobby Design, and Racing Decals 43) don't have the bleed through issue. I'll still happily use SK's decals, because they're so good. If I decide to battle the Revell Ford GTLM next, I'll be trying some decals from Decalcas. They're surprisingly thick for "modern" decals, so we'll see how that goes.
